JOB PACKAGE
This assignment will give you practice researching an organization you're applying to and writing a cover letter and resume. You will practice creating a resume and cover letter that is tailored to the specific job and organisation and based on your real-life abilities and experience. Youll be using job search skills for the rest of your life. Practice the skills which will help you prepare to win the job you really want.
What you're handing in:
1. An analysis
2. A cover letter
3. A one-page resume
1. Analysis. Using the job advertisement that you chose, prepare a 1 page analysis made up of three parts.
a. The first part of the analysis will give a description of the position and the organization you are applying to. DO NOT CUT AND PASTE tell me in your own words. You will have to do a little research to find out about the organization. For example, youll certainly need to know who will look at your resume, as well as any other information that might help you tailor your resume and cover letter. Dont spend too much time on the research, but you will want to achieve two goals. You will want to be able to connect your qualifications to the organization and the position.
b. In the second part explain to me how you have tailored your resume to this job, interviewer and organization. Explain what youve highlighted and why. Explain design choices and content choices. This is your way of proving to me that this is not a generic resume, but one that is specifically tailored to the job you want.
c. In the third part, write two paragraphs describing the kind of feedback you received on your assignment and what you have done to address that in this assignment.
2. Cover Memo Write a one-page cover letter based on the strategies covered in your text and the PowerPoint presentations. Be sure to follow proper letter format, use the persuasive strategy and tailor the letter to the job, the interviewer and the organization.
3. Resume Write a one to two page resume that matches the position you're applying for. Be sure to organize and word the information and design the resume to match expectations within that actual field. Your resume should be recognizable at a glance as belonging to your particular career field.
